Check Power Supply And Outlet

Before delving into complex troubleshooting, start by ensuring that the Koolatron cooler is properly connected to a power source and that the outlet is functioning correctly. Verify that the cooler is securely plugged into a power outlet and that the outlet itself is working by testing it with another device. Sometimes a loose connection or a faulty outlet can be the simple reason why your cooler is not chilling.

If the cooler is powered by a DC adapter, make sure the adapter is securely plugged into both the cooler and the power source. Check for any visible damage to the power cord or adapter that could be causing the cooler not to receive power. Be sure to also inspect the power switch of the cooler to confirm that it is in the ON position. Troubleshooting power supply issues should always be the first step in diagnosing cooling problems with your Koolatron cooler.

Inspect For Frost Build-Up

Frost build-up inside your Koolatron cooler can be a common culprit for inadequate cooling. When there is excessive frost accumulation on the cooling coils, it can hinder the proper transfer of heat, resulting in decreased chilling performance. To address this issue, unplug the cooler and allow it to defrost completely. This process might take a few hours, but it is essential for restoring optimal cooling functionality.

Once the frost has melted, carefully inspect the interior of the cooler to ensure there is no residual moisture. Use a clean, dry cloth to wipe down the surfaces and remove any water droplets. Additionally, check the door seal for any gaps or damage that could be allowing warm air to enter the cooler, leading to frost build-up. Proper maintenance and regular defrosting can help prevent this issue from recurring and keep your Koolatron cooler operating efficiently.

Test The Thermoelectric System

To test the thermoelectric system of your Koolatron cooler, start by checking if the fan is running. The fan helps dissipate heat from the system, so if it’s not working, the cooler won’t chill properly. Inspect the fan for any debris or obstructions that may be hindering its operation. Clean the fan blades and make sure they are spinning freely.

Next, check the power source to ensure the thermoelectric system is receiving adequate power. If the power supply is interrupted or insufficient, the system may not function correctly. Verify that the cooler is plugged into a working outlet and that the power cord is not damaged. Consider testing the cooler with a different power source to rule out any issues with the original outlet.

If the fan is running smoothly and the power source is confirmed to be functioning, but the cooler still won’t chill, there may be an underlying issue with the thermoelectric system itself. In this case, it is recommended to contact Koolatron customer support or a qualified technician for further assistance in diagnosing and resolving the problem.

Evaluate Surrounding Environment

To ensure optimal performance of your Koolatron cooler, evaluating the surrounding environment is crucial. Make sure the cooler is not placed in direct sunlight or near a heat source such as an oven or radiator. Excessive heat from these sources can hinder the cooler’s ability to chill effectively.

Additionally, check for proper ventilation around the cooler. Adequate airflow is essential for the cooling system to work efficiently. Ensure there is enough space around the cooler for air to circulate freely, and avoid placing it in enclosed areas or tight spaces that restrict airflow.

Lastly, consider the ambient temperature of the room where the cooler is located. Extremely high ambient temperatures can put extra strain on the cooling mechanism, leading to decreased performance. Ideally, the cooler should be placed in a cool, well-ventilated area with a consistent temperature to maximize its chilling capabilities.
